The Mariners are 2 for 2 so far this season playing in home openers. On Thursday, they go for No. 3.

James Paxton will be on the mound for Seattle as it looks to spoil the Twins’ first game this season at Target Field in Minneapolis, just like the M’s did on Tuesday with a 6-4 win over the Giants in San Francisco. The Mariners also won their own home opener on opening night a week ago.

In the Mariners’ lineup will be Mitch Haniger again hitting cleanup in place of the injured Nelson Cruz, Daniel Vogelbach at DH, and David Freitas catching Paxton.

The Twins will counter with right-hander Kyle Gibson as their starting pitcher.

Temperatures are plenty cold in Minnesota, where there was nine inches of snow on the field as of yesterday. Shannon Drayer has more on what to expect during the Mariners’ four-day, three-game stay in the Land of 10,000 Lakes.

Thursday’s game coverage begins at noon with the pregame show on 710 ESPN Seattle, followed by first pitch at 1:10.
